Common Arborvitae Pruning Jobs
Arborvitae Pruning - shaping and reducing overgrown arborvitae for a healthier appearance.
Arborvitae Trimming - maintaining uniform height and density to enhance curb appeal.
Arborvitae Thinning - removing interior branches to improve airflow and light penetration.
Arborvitae Crown Reduction - carefully lowering the top of the hedge to control size.
Arborvitae Deadwood Removal - eliminating damaged or diseased branches to promote growth.
Arborvitae Shaping - creating precise forms to suit landscape design preferences.
Arborvitae Pruning Questions
Why is arborvitae pruning important? Proper pruning helps maintain the shape, health, and density of arborvitae, preventing overgrowth and improving appearance.
When is the best time to prune arborvitae? The ideal time is late winter to early spring before new growth begins, ensuring healthy development.
Can arborvitae be pruned for shaping? Yes, trimming can enhance the natural form or create a desired hedge or screen.
What should property owners know about pruning techniques? Using clean, sharp tools and avoiding excessive cutting helps prevent damage and promotes healthy growth.
